Introducing CoreMatrix™ Technology
Enabling the most flexible and lightweight ballistic protection
Arclin CoreMatrix™ Technology is a process that combines numerous woven layers by infusing staple fiber in the z direction. This hybrid structure is extremely soft and flexible while increasing the overall ballistic performance for bullet threats and fragmentation protection. Along with the proven performance of Arclin fiber technology, CoreMatrix™ Technology will enable the lightest, most flexible ballistic solutions that meet the new National Institute of Justice (NIJ) standards for enhanced durability.
CoreMatrix™ Technology delivers the most advanced ballistic protection that military, law enforcement and global security officers require for ballistic threats while increasing flexibility and comfort.

Arclin fiber technology with CoreMatrix™ Technology provides revolutionary edge shot and multi-threat protection. CoreMatrix™ is best suited in hybrid ballistic packages as a strike-face and body side material.
